 Weird Al's "Yoda" is a playful parody of The Kinks’ "Lola," so listening to the original can offer inspiration for the song’s upbeat, bouncy feel. The chords and rhythm are accessible for beginners.


Strumming Pattern
A simple down-up-down-up (D-U-D-U) pattern works well. Try a steady eighth-note strum, accenting the second and fourth beats to capture the original’s groove. For an even easier approach, use all downstrokes.


Chord Tips

  • The main chords are E, A, D, and C. Practice switching between E and A, as this is a common transition.
  • For the bridge, you’ll encounter B7 and F#. B7 is more beginner-friendly than B major, so use the open shape. F# may be tricky; if needed, play only the top four strings or substitute with an easier F# minor 7 shape.
  • The second bridge uses F#m and C#m. These barre chords can be challenging, so take your time, or use simplified versions (like F#m7 and C#m7).
